Palasport Mens Sana
Palasport Mens Sana is an indoor sporting arena located in Via Sclavo, Siena, Italy. The seating capacity of the arena is for 6,000 people. Opened in 1976, it is currently home to the Mens Sana Basket professional basketball team.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Siena railway station
Railway station
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Siena railway station serves the city and comune of Siena, in the region of Tuscany, central Italy. Opened in 1935, it is the terminus of the lines to Empoli, to Chiusi and to Grosseto via Monte Antico. Siena railway station is situated 790 metres east of Palasport Mens Sana.
